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Waldorf

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Storm Chaser Scams

Out-of-town crews swarm after bad weather, offer 'bargain' roof replacements, collect big deposits, then disappear or do shoddy work.

🚫

Upfront Payment Traps

Contractor demands 50%+ cash or full payment before starting, then ghosts or starts and abandons the job.

🚫

Bait-and-Switch Pricing

Quotes a low price to get in, then 'discovers' extra damage needing thousands more, pressuring for immediate upsell.

🚫

Cheap Materials Fraud

Promises premium shingles but installs low-grade ones that fail quickly, denying the switch.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) for general liability (at least $50K) and workers' compensation. Call the insurance carrier listed on the COI to confirm it's current and valid. Don't accept just a verbal promise.

2

Licensing

Maryland roofers must be licensed by the Maryland Home Improvement Commission (MHIC). Ask for their MHIC license number and verify it's active on the MHIC website: mhic.maryland.gov. Check for any complaints or disciplinary actions.

3

References

Insist on 3+ recent references from Waldorf or Charles County jobs. Call each one to ask about work quality, timeliness, cleanup, and if they'd rehire. Verify the references are real and local.

Protection FAQs

Do roofing contractors need a license in Maryland?

Yes, all home improvement work over $500 requires MHIC registration. Verify the license number at mhic.maryland.gov to ensure it's active and complaint-free.

How do I verify a roofer's insurance?

Get a COI directly from their insurer showing coverage dates and limits. Call the carrier to confirm—no broker copies.

What should I do right after storm damage in Waldorf?

Tarp the roof temporarily to prevent interior damage. Avoid signing with door-knockers. Get 3+ bids from local verified pros.

Is a written contract always necessary for roofing?

Absolutely—verbal agreements offer no protection. It should detail scope, materials, timeline, payments, and warranties.

What are common signs of a roofing scam?

Upfront full payments, no paperwork, out-of-state plates, too-good-to-be-true deals, or pressure to decide now.

How can I find trustworthy roofers in Waldorf?

Check MHIC licensing, insurance, references. Look for local presence, detailed bids, and no high-pressure sales. Connect with pre-screened professionals.

What permits are needed for roofing in Charles County?

Most roof replacements require a building permit from Charles County. Trustworthy pros handle this and pull them before starting.
